通过与 Jira 对比,让您更全面了解 PingCode

  • 首页
  • 需求与产品管理
  • 项目管理
  • 测试与缺陷管理
  • 知识管理
  • 效能度量
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案

25人以下免费

目录

编程管理文档怎么做出来的

编程管理文档怎么做出来的

编程管理文档的制作是一个系统性的过程,涉及到需求分析、文档规划、内容编写、审阅与发布等多个环节。首先,需求分析是基础,需要明确文档的目标受众、用途和预期效果。紧接着,文档规划环节要确定文档的结构、格式和风格指南,保证文档的一致性和易用性。在内容编写阶段,编写者应详细解释代码的功能、用法、设计理念及相关的配置信息等,而且应该确保内容的准确性和可理解性。审阅与发布环节则是保证文档质量的关键,需要通过团队内部的审阅或者外部专家的评审来提升文档质量。最后,发布后还需要定期更新和维护文档,以适应软件的迭代更新。下面,我们将对这些环节进行详细的分析。

一、 需求分析

在编写管理文档之前,首先需要进行深入的需求分析。这一阶段的目标是明确文档的受众、目的和预期达成的效果。这对于确保文档的有效性至关重要。

  • 确定文档受众:文档的受众可能是内部开发人员、测试人员、项目管理人员、最终用户或者其他利益相关者。了解受众的背景知识和需求可以帮助编写者调整内容的深度和广度,以及采用最合适的表达方式。
  • 明确文档目的:文档的目的可能是帮助开发人员理解软件架构、指导用户如何使用软件、记录软件的变更历史等。明确目的有助于确定文档的重点内容和结构。

二、 文档规划

在需求分析的基础上,进一步制定文档的规划,这包括确定文档的结构、格式和风格指南。

  • 设计文档结构:文档的结构应当逻辑清晰,易于阅读和检索。常见的结构包括目录、引言、正文(功能描述、安装配置、使用示例等)、术语表和附录等。
  • 确定文档风格和格式:为了保证文档的一致性和专业性,需要制定统一的风格指南和格式规范。这包括字体的选择、代码示例的呈现方式、标题层级的定义等。

三、 内容编写

内容编写是编程管理文档制作过程中的核心环节,需要详细、准确地描述软件的功能、设计理念、使用方法等。

  • 详细解释代码功能和用法:对于软件的每一个功能,文档都应提供详细的描述、参数说明和使用示例。这有助于用户快速理解和使用软件。
  • 阐述设计理念和配置信息:除了具体的使用方法,文档还应解释软件的设计理念、配置过程和最佳实践等。这有助于用户更深入地理解软件,从而更有效地使用和维护。

四、 审阅与发布

编写完成后,文档需要经过严格的审阅和测试,以确保内容的准确性、完整性和易用性。

  • 内部审阅和外部评审:文档应先由编写者或团队内部成员进行审阅,然后再由外部专家或目标用户进行评审。这有助于发现并改进文档中的不足之处。
  • 文档的测试和优化:实际使用文档进行软件安装、配置和使用的测试,可以进一步验证文档的准确性和易用性。根据测试结果调整和优化文档内容。

五、 维护与更新

软件的迭代更新要求文档内容也需要定期进行维护和更新,以保持文档的有效性和相关性。

  • 定期检查和更新:定期回顾文档,根据软件的更新和用户反馈,及时修正错误和添加新内容。
  • 持续改进文档质量:通过收集用户反馈、监控文档使用情况等手段,不断评估和改进文档的质量和可用性。

编程管理文档的制作是一个动态且持续的过程,它要求编写者不仅要有深厚的技术功底,还需要良好的沟通和组织能力。通过遵循上述步骤和原则,可以制作出既专业又易用的管理文档,有效支持软件的开发、使用和维护工作。

相关问答FAQs:

1. 如何创建一个高效的编程管理文档?

  • 问题:我想创建一个高效的编程管理文档,有什么建议吗?
  • 回答:要创建一个高效的编程管理文档,首先需要明确文档的目的和受众。然后,确定文档的结构和格式,确保信息的组织和呈现清晰易懂。另外,可以使用合适的工具和技术,如版本控制系统和在线协作平台,以便团队成员能够方便地访问和更新文档。还可以考虑添加示例代码、截图和流程图等可视化元素,以增强文档的可读性和可理解性。

2. 编程管理文档应该包含哪些内容?

  • 问题:我正在制作一个编程管理文档,应该包含哪些内容?
  • 回答:编程管理文档应该包含项目的基本信息,如项目名称、描述和目标。此外,还应包含编程规范、代码库结构、开发流程和团队成员的角色和职责等内容。还可以添加代码示例、常见问题解答和常用工具的使用说明等辅助信息,以帮助团队成员更好地理解和使用文档。

3. 如何保持编程管理文档的更新和维护?

  • 问题:我制作了一个编程管理文档,但如何确保它始终保持最新和有效?
  • 回答:要保持编程管理文档的更新和维护,首先需要设定一个明确的更新计划,并指定负责人负责文档的更新和维护工作。定期回顾文档,检查其中的信息是否仍然准确和有效,并根据需要进行修改和更新。另外,可以与团队成员保持沟通,收集他们的反馈和建议,以便及时更新和改进文档。最后,将文档存储在可访问的位置,并确保团队成员能够方便地访问和使用文档。
相关文章